Graduates from tertiary education 4.6/g1C 6.17 5.42 Health Indicatr Unit Value Prevalence of gender violence in lifetime % women 19.00 Births attended by skilled personnel % live births 64.40 Maternal mortality deaths per 100,000 live births 112.00 Total fertility rate births per woman 2.42 Indicatr Equal rights Value Reproductive autonomy Restricted rights *Scores are on a 0 to 1 scale, where 1 represents the optimal situation or “parity ”. Please see Appendix A and B for detailed methodology, de finitions, sources and periods. **For all indicators, except the two health indicators, parity is benchmarked at 1. In the case of sex ratio at birth, the gender parity benchmark is set at 0.944 hgFsee hglklasen and Wink, 2003hgji. In the case of healthy life expectancy the gender parity benchmark is set at 1.06, given women's longer life expectancy.Global Gender Gap Report 2025 240
